Top 20 Environmental Chemistry MCQs with Answers

These public questions are selected from the exact Environmental Chemistry chapter, screened for topic relevance and deduplicated so repeated versions of the same MCQ are not shown publicly. WBCHSE Class 11 Chemistry · Environmental Chemistry · Very Hard

1. The lowest layer of the atmosphere is:

  • A. Mesosphere
  • B. Thermosphere
  • C. Troposphere
  • D. Stratosphere
Answer: C
Explanation: The troposphere extends upward from Earth's surface and contains most atmospheric mass.

WBCHSE Class 11 Chemistry · Environmental Chemistry · Very Hard

2. Most weather phenomena occur in the:

  • A. Exosphere
  • B. Troposphere
  • C. Stratosphere
  • D. Mesosphere
Answer: B
Explanation: Clouds and weather are concentrated in the troposphere.

WBCHSE Class 11 Chemistry · Environmental Chemistry · Very Hard

3. The ozone layer is concentrated mainly in the:

  • A. Stratosphere
  • B. Troposphere
  • C. Mesosphere
  • D. Lithosphere
Answer: A
Explanation: Stratospheric ozone absorbs much harmful ultraviolet radiation.

WBCHSE Class 11 Chemistry · Environmental Chemistry · Very Hard

4. An important natural greenhouse gas is:

  • A. O2
  • B. N2
  • C. He
  • D. CO2
Answer: D
Explanation: Carbon dioxide absorbs outgoing infrared radiation and contributes to the greenhouse effect.

WBCHSE Class 11 Chemistry · Environmental Chemistry · Very Hard

5. Which gas is a major anthropogenic greenhouse gas?

  • A. Ar
  • B. He
  • C. CO2
  • D. Ne
Answer: C
Explanation: Human activities have substantially increased atmospheric CO2.

WBCHSE Class 11 Chemistry · Environmental Chemistry · Very Hard

6. Methane contributes to:

  • A. Removal of all aerosols
  • B. Greenhouse warming
  • C. Ozone formation only in stratosphere
  • D. Acid rain as the main cause
Answer: B
Explanation: Methane is an effective greenhouse gas.

WBCHSE Class 11 Chemistry · Environmental Chemistry · Very Hard

7. Global warming refers to a long-term rise in:

  • A. Earth's average surface temperature
  • B. Ocean salinity only
  • C. Atmospheric nitrogen percentage only
  • D. Earth's mass
Answer: A
Explanation: Enhanced greenhouse forcing raises global mean temperature.

WBCHSE Class 11 Chemistry · Environmental Chemistry · Very Hard

8. The principal gases responsible for acid rain include:

  • A. O2 and N2
  • B. H2 and He
  • C. CH4 and Ne
  • D. SO2 and nitrogen oxides
Answer: D
Explanation: Sulfur and nitrogen oxides form sulfuric and nitric acids in the atmosphere.

WBCHSE Class 11 Chemistry · Environmental Chemistry · Very Hard

9. Acid rain can damage:

  • A. Only deep ocean trenches
  • B. Nothing made of carbonate
  • C. Aquatic ecosystems, soils and monuments
  • D. Only noble gases
Answer: C
Explanation: Acid deposition affects ecosystems and attacks materials such as limestone and marble.

WBCHSE Class 11 Chemistry · Environmental Chemistry · Very Hard

10. Photochemical smog is favoured by:

  • A. Absence of sunlight
  • B. Sunlight, NOx and hydrocarbons/VOCs
  • C. Only nitrogen and argon
  • D. Heavy rain only
Answer: B
Explanation: Sunlight drives reactions involving nitrogen oxides and volatile organics.

WBCHSE Class 11 Chemistry · Environmental Chemistry · Very Hard

11. A major component of photochemical smog is:

  • A. Ozone
  • B. Helium
  • C. Hydrogen
  • D. Nitrogen gas only
Answer: A
Explanation: Ground-level ozone is a key secondary photochemical pollutant.

WBCHSE Class 11 Chemistry · Environmental Chemistry · Very Hard

12. Classical reducing smog is associated strongly with:

  • A. Ozone and PAN only
  • B. Helium and neon
  • C. Hydrogen and oxygen
  • D. SO2 and particulate matter
Answer: D
Explanation: Sulfurous smog forms under cool, humid conditions with sulfur dioxide and smoke.

WBCHSE Class 11 Chemistry · Environmental Chemistry · Very Hard

13. PAN in photochemical smog stands for:

  • A. Peroxide ammonia nitrite
  • B. Phosphorus acetate nitrate
  • C. Peroxyacetyl nitrate
  • D. Polyatomic acid nitrate
Answer: C
Explanation: PAN is peroxyacetyl nitrate, a secondary photochemical pollutant.

WBCHSE Class 11 Chemistry · Environmental Chemistry · Very Hard

14. Carbon monoxide is dangerous because it binds strongly to:

  • A. Calcium carbonate
  • B. Haemoglobin
  • C. Cellulose
  • D. Chlorophyll in humans
Answer: B
Explanation: CO forms carboxyhaemoglobin and reduces oxygen transport.

WBCHSE Class 11 Chemistry · Environmental Chemistry · Very Hard

15. Particulate matter can harm health mainly by affecting the:

  • A. Respiratory system
  • B. Atomic nucleus
  • C. Bone mineral only
  • D. DNA bases exclusively
Answer: A
Explanation: Fine particles can penetrate the respiratory tract.

WBCHSE Class 11 Chemistry · Environmental Chemistry · Very Hard

16. A primary pollutant is one that is:

  • A. Always formed only in sunlight
  • B. Never emitted directly
  • C. Necessarily harmless
  • D. Emitted directly from a source
Answer: D
Explanation: Primary pollutants enter the environment directly from identifiable sources.

WBCHSE Class 11 Chemistry · Environmental Chemistry · Very Hard

17. A secondary pollutant is:

  • A. Always a metal
  • B. Always biodegradable
  • C. Formed in the environment by reactions of primary pollutants
  • D. Always emitted directly
Answer: C
Explanation: Secondary pollutants such as ozone can form through atmospheric chemistry.

WBCHSE Class 11 Chemistry · Environmental Chemistry · Very Hard

18. Stratospheric ozone protects life by absorbing much:

  • A. Sound
  • B. UV radiation
  • C. Visible red light only
  • D. Radio waves
Answer: B
Explanation: Ozone strongly absorbs biologically harmful UV radiation.

WBCHSE Class 11 Chemistry · Environmental Chemistry · Very Hard

19. Ozone depletion has been strongly associated with:

  • A. CFCs
  • B. CO2 alone
  • C. N2
  • D. Water vapour only
Answer: A
Explanation: CFC-derived chlorine radicals catalyse ozone destruction.

WBCHSE Class 11 Chemistry · Environmental Chemistry · Very Hard

20. CFCs release ozone-destroying radicals after exposure to:

  • A. Visible light in soil only
  • B. Sound waves
  • C. Magnetic fields
  • D. UV radiation in the stratosphere
Answer: D
Explanation: High-energy UV photolyses CFCs and liberates chlorine radicals.
